Use Case:
AT System Start - Day-time to observation mode transition
Description:
This is the normal operation to switch the system from
day-time to observation mode.
Each required sub-system used during observation is brought from state
STANDBY to state ONLINE, i.e. all sub-systems are completely activated and the
telescope is under position control, ready to move at next operative command.
Subsystems used during day-time only, are switched off or to STANDBY
state.
A failure will leave the ATCS in state STANDBY substate ERROR.
Role(s)/Actor(s):
Primary: Operator, Maintenance
Secondary: Standard Packages
Priority: Desirable. The sequence can always be performed step by step by the operator.
Performance: 10 minutes.
Frequency: Typically, once
per day at start of night. Occasionally, a few times per night.
Preconditions:
Basic
Course:
- Send command STRTATS
to Start AT System
Exception Course: Command failed
- ATCS puts in STANDBY (or OFF) all not ignored subsystems
used in day-time mode
Exception Course: Some sub-systems failed
to go in STANDBY (or OFF)
Postcondition: all not ignored subsystems
used in day-time mode are in STANDBY (or OFF) state
- ATCS Start
Exception Course: Failed to start ATCS
- ATCS Set APD Gate to 0%
Postconditions: APD Gate is open
- ATCS Set Coude Beam switching device to Light Stop
Postconditions: Light Stop in Beam
- ATCS Stop Air Conditioning
Postconditions: Air Conditioning is stopped
- ATCS Open Enclosure
Postconditions: Telescope enclosure is open
- Open ROS Shutter with Control Relay Optics Structure Shutter
Postconditions: ROS Shutter is Open

Postconditions:
- ATCS is in state ONLINE, substate IDLE (this implies telescope axes under position control)
- Enclosure is open
- ROS Shutter is open
- Light Stop in Coudé Beam
- APD Gate is 0
- All required and not ignored ATS subsystems
used in observation mode are initialized and in ONLINE (control
loops are enabled and brakes disengaged)
- All ATCS not ignored subsystems used in day-time mode are
in STANDBY (or OFF) state
